What is the purpose of a NMEA 2000 backbone/drop cable?

A NMEA 2000 backbone/drop cable is designed to facilitate the connection of marine electronic devices to a central NMEA 2000 network. The backbone cable forms the main data highway, while drop cables connect individual devices to this backbone via T-connectors.
